To support the Dive In Festival helping insurance to get fit for the future, highlighting the business case for divers and inclusive workplaces and providing practical ideas and inspiration to support positive change.

The session is required to offer members a basic understanding regarding equality, diversity and inclusion, the business case and unconscious bias.

Learning objectives:
By the end of the session, delegates will be able to identify:
• compliance, legislation and good practice
• business case for diversity and inclusion – moral and commercial impact
• diversity issues difference, privilege, bias and social mobility
• how to advocate change
• how to build strategies

Speakers biography:
Sharon has over 20 years’ experience in Human Resources, specialising in diversity and inclusion. Starting her career in Financial Services before moving across to HR. Sharon is considered to be a thought leader in this area, consulting on many white papers for the Government in areas of disability, gender and LGBT+. In 2017 Sharon will be releasing a three-year study on the “ageing workforce” the first in depth study in the UK.

During her career Sharon has supported many organisations on their way to success and recognised through the following frameworks: BITC Race and Gender, Top Employers, Time Top 50 Employers for Women, Stonewall, Disability Standards, Equality Standard for Local Government and CPA.

Sharon is also a NED for Ditch the Label Anti-Bullying Charity and Inclusive Employers. Sharon strongly believes in giving back, co-founding Northern Hive connecting businesses, Community and Education across the North.
